Top 5 Vietnamese in Los Angeles
The LA County Vietnamese canon as reflected by cross-publication consensus — from the SGV's Hanoi-style phở bắc temple to Chinatown's old-guard and modern-flagship standouts.
- #1
Phở Filet
South El Monte
“Jonathan Gold's Hanoi-style phở bắc destination — minimalist, filet-mignon-slivered broth that Time Out LA now ranks #1 in the city.”
- #2
Phở 87
Chinatown
“A 36-year Chinatown institution whose deeply beefy, almost funky broth is the platonic LA-proper bowl of pho.”
- #3
Sage Blossom
Chinatown
“The sun-drenched Central Plaza flagship of the Blossom family — silky pho dac biet, crackling bánh xèo, and the deepest menu of the group.”
- #4
Nem Nướng Khánh Hoà
Alhambra
“The Central Vietnamese specialist Angelenos drive to for grilled-to-order nem nướng rolls and a standout bún bò Huế.”
- #5
Thien Huong Restaurant
Chinatown
“Far East Plaza's old-guard Vietnamese anchor — dependable pho, bún bò Huế, and nine bánh mì for under seven bucks.”
